The brief

1.

The London Borough of Tower Hamlets (LBTH) is relocating its Town Hall and consolidating its back-office provision to a new Civic Centre building at the site of the old Royal London Hospital in Whitechapel Road.

The project aims to enable the Council's Transformation Strategy, through aligned strategies such as: new ways of working, workforce transformation, and digital transformation.

2.

The Council has not deployed BIM on any project to date and would like to use the Civic Centre project as an early adopter/pilot project for the Borough.

The aspiration is that through the deployment of BIM, the Council will be able to deliver whole life efficiencies.

3.

The Council does not have the relevant expertise in house to adopt BIM on the Civic Centre project.

As such, the Project Leadership team are looking to bring on board external support to help develop the strategic approach, whilst providing operational capacity to carry out the client's obligations throughout the design phase.

Subject to adoption of the strategic approach by the Council, the intention would be to build capacity within the Council which could take on the client functions from the partner.

4.

The Civic Centre Project is currently at the end of Stage 1 RIBA design, with Stage 2 due to be instructed in January 2017.

The development will involve the refurbishment, with significant new build, of a Grade II Listed building.

The Project has a Lead Designer and Consultant in place (AHMM), who will carry out the role of BIM Coordinator.

Further context on the proposed development will be shared at the introductory briefing meeting on the 19th December.

5.

The Council envisages three strands to the engagement: a.

Strand 1 - Strategic Approach and Business Case, b.

Strand 2 - Operational Implementation, and c.

Strand 3 - Training and BAU Handover.

6.

The success of strand 1 will determine the nature and duration of the engagement, with a maximum initial project duration of 14 months (or end Stage 3, whichever is the latter).

A separate procurement may then be carried out to support the project through the latter phases of its lifecycle.

7.

In order to meet the needs of the project programme, it is envisaged that elements of each strand may be progressed concurrently (subject to the successful partner's proposed approach to the engagement).
